Northern Ohio American Red Cross Volunteer Recruitment @ College Hall 148
Nov 2 @ 11:00 am – 1:00 pm

Kevin Brooks from American Red Cross will be available in the Center for Campus and Community Connections to meet with students interested in learning more about becoming a disaster relief volunteer.

November 2

11 a.m. – 1 p.m.

College Hall 148

Volunteers carry out 90% of the humanitarian work of the Red Cross. Volunteer needs include:

• Respond to local disasters, most commonly home fires, to help with immediate needs.
• Deploy to large scale disasters such as hurricanes and wildfires to provide shelter support.
• Greet, check in and thank blood donors at blood drives.
• Provide support to military members, veterans and their families.
